$ git add 怎么使用

不及物动词 其他 177

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    使用git add命令可以将文件或文件夹添加到暂存区,准备将其提交到版本控制系统。

    在使用git add命令时,有以下几种常见的用法:

    1. 添加单个文件:可以使用以下命令添加单个文件到暂存区:
    “`shell
    $ git add
    “`
    其中,`
    `表示要添加的文件路径。

    2. 添加多个文件:可以使用以下命令添加多个文件到暂存区:
    “`shell
    $ git add
    “`
    其中,` …`表示要添加的多个文件路径。

    3. 添加指定文件夹:可以使用以下命令添加指定文件夹及其子文件夹下的所有文件到暂存区:
    “`shell
    $ git add
    “`
    其中,`
    `表示要添加的文件夹路径。

    4. 添加所有文件:可以使用以下命令添加当前目录下所有文件及文件夹到暂存区:
    “`shell
    $ git add .
    “`
    注意,`.`表示当前目录。

    5. 添加文件的部分内容:可以使用以下命令添加文件的部分内容到暂存区:
    “`shell
    $ git add -p
    “`
    这将会进入交互式模式,根据提示逐个选择要添加的内容段落。

    除了上述常用的用法外,git add命令还支持一些其他选项,例如:

    – `-u`:添加已修改或已删除的文件,但不包括新添加的文件。
    – `-A`:添加所有已修改、已删除和新添加的文件。

    值得注意的是,使用git add命令只是将文件添加到暂存区,并没有提交到版本控制系统。为了将更改提交,请使用git commit命令。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Git是一个版本控制系统,它可以跟踪文件的变化并记录修改历史。其中一个重要的Git命令是`git add`,它用于将文件添加到暂存区,从而使得这些文件可以在下一次提交时被版本控制。

    使用`git add`命令的方式有以下几种:

    1. 添加单个文件:可以使用以下命令将指定的文件添加到暂存区:
    “`
    git add <文件名>
    “`

    2. 添加指定类型的文件:可以使用通配符`*`添加指定类型的文件,例如:
    “`
    git add *.txt
    “`

    3. 添加所有文件:使用以下命令可以将所有修改过的文件添加到暂存区:
    “`
    git add .
    “`

    4. 交互式添加:可以使用交互式模式添加文件,该模式允许您选择要添加的文件。使用以下命令启动交互式模式:
    “`
    git add -i
    “`

    5. 添加所有文件,包括删除的文件:有时候,您可能需要将所有被修改、被删除的文件都添加到暂存区。可以使用以下命令进行操作:
    “`
    git add –all
    “`

    使用`git add`命令时还可以使用一些选项来修改其行为:

    – `-p`选项:允许您选择性地添加文件的部分内容。这在您只想添加文件的一部分更改时非常有用。

    – `-u`选项:只添加已跟踪文件的更改,不包括新添加的文件。

    总结:`git add`命令用于将文件添加到Git的暂存区,以便在下一次提交时被版本控制。有多种用法和选项,可以根据需要添加单个文件、指定类型的文件、所有修改过的文件,甚至可以进行交互式添加。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Git add 是Git命令中的一个重要命令,用于将文件添加到缓冲区(暂存区)。在提交文件之前,我们需要使用该命令将要提交的文件添加到暂存区,以便Git跟踪这些文件的更改。

    下面是git add命令的使用方法和操作流程:

    1. 在命令行中进入要操作的Git仓库所在的目录。

    2. 检查仓库的状态,可以使用`git status`命令查看当前工作目录和缓冲区的状态。

    3. 使用`git add`命令将文件添加到缓冲区。有以下几种使用方式:

    a. 添加单个文件:`git add <文件路径>`,例如 `git add index.html`。这将把指定的文件添加到缓冲区。

    b. 添加多个文件:`git add <文件路径1> <文件路径2> …`,例如`git add index.html style.css`。这将把指定的多个文件添加到缓冲区。

    c. 添加所有文件:`git add .`,或者 `git add –all`,或者 `git add -A`。这将把当前目录下的所有文件添加到缓冲区。

    d. 添加指定类型的文件:`git add *.<文件类型>`,例如 `git add *.html`。这将添加所有指定文件类型的文件到缓冲区。

    4. 再次使用`git status`命令检查仓库的状态,确认文件是否已经成功添加到缓冲区。

    5. 如果要修改已经添加到缓冲区的文件,可以直接修改文件内容。修改后,再次使用`git add`命令将文件的更改添加到缓冲区。

    6. 如果要取消对文件的添加操作,可以使用`git reset`命令。例如 `git reset <文件路径>`或者 `git reset`(取消所有文件的添加)。

    7. 最后,使用`git commit`命令将缓冲区的文件提交到本地仓库。例如 `git commit -m “提交说明”`。

    总结:Git add 命令的作用是将文件添加到缓冲区,它是Git提交流程中的一个重要步骤。通过指定文件路径、文件类型、添加所有文件等方式,我们可以将需要提交的文件添加到缓冲区。添加后的文件可以进行修改,然后再次使用git add命令将修改的内容添加到缓冲区。最后,使用git commit命令将缓冲区的文件提交到本地仓库。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部